Most bodies now days are either metal or ABS. You'd be hard pressed to find a nylon body, but I agree with you V3>V2.

No G36 body is metal, on account of the real one being composite (like the SCAR's lower, P90, FN2000, etc.). The G36 is the only airsoft gun I've seen made with a nylon or fibre body. Consequently ARES and CA (both glass-reinforced fibre or nylon composite) have the best G36 bodies. WAY more sturdy than ABS, far stronger too. Like you said though most are ABS. I'm not a fan of ABS bodies, especially for bigger guns. The amount of flex in something like a TM G3-SG1 is nuts.

Fair word of warning. G&G CM replicas suck. Bad motor, can't pull anything stronger than the stock spring, non heat treated gears, horrible wiring and I can go on and on about it. However, for the price, they have some of the best externals on the market (Again, that's for the price)

You would be much safer off going with a JG, Echo-1 or CYMA replica.

I have lots of airsoft stuff, I've played since about 99. Here in Guernsey we play in an old German Underground Bunker called the Mirus it's one bunker that formed a part of a battery here in Guernsey. My island was occuppied by German Forces during World War II (the only part of the British Isles to be controlled by Nazi Germany).

Because of this most people using specialised CQB rigs with torches and tracers as standard.
